James Bond night, The Maharaja Express and a meal out with Tornado, all on the line soon!
Following a sell out of both dining trains planned for Sunday 14th of February, the GCR has given lovers an extra chance to be romantic this coming weekend.
An additional first class luxury dining train has been added to the timetable for Saturday the 13th of February. The train departs Loughborough at 7.30pm and returns around 10pm. A five course meal including coffee will be served during the journey. Tickets cost £42 per person (£30.50 for First Class members of the Friends of the Great Central Main Line).
Meanwhile, lovers of the worlds most famous secret agents can indulge their fantasies for one night only on Friday 5th of March (departing 7.30pm) A special dining train dedicated to all things 007 promises to be a top notch evening you don't need to be Goldfinger to afford. Would be spies can mingle with other characters on the platform and order up a whole range of cocktails to leave you shaken and stirred. A steam engine simmering nearby at the head of your first class dining train promises towhisk you into a night of atmosphere. You will be entertained by a magician and be able to spot famous villains lurking in the shadows. On board the train you'll be treated to a 3 course meal on a sixteen mile journey through the Leicestershire night - or is it across the border behind the iron curtain?! Guests are asked to dress to impress with outfits which any Roger, Pierce, Plenty or Vespa might slip into (or out of...). For once the world will be enough and the evening is just £37 per person.
On March 17th (St Patricks Day) - it's not a takeway its a takeover! Staff from Loughborough's Salim's Indian Restaurant will swap their stationary kitchen for a galley on the move as they bring some Eastern flavour to the Great Central Railway. Salim's will create a curry sensation on board the lines famous dining train. Guests will be greeted in full Indian costume and treated to traditional music. The train has been grandly titled the Maharaja Express! A three course menu will be served and tickets cost just £30 per person including first class rail tickets.
Finally for a very exclusive night out. On Friday 2nd of April, the Great Central Railway is proud to present a super exclusive first class dining train hauled by Tornado. The celebrity engine has appeared on television and is known around the world. So how about a steamy encounter with it? The evening begins at 6.30pm at Loughborough Central with a champagne and canapé reception. Diners will be entertained by a jazz band while they explore the station and admire the locomotive.
The train departs at 7.30pm and makes two return journeys to Leicester North. The exciting menu has seven courses. During the evening, the chairman of the A1 trust which built the loco will be present for a Q & A session. The train finally returns to Loughborough at 11pm.
